Cyngn Inc. specializes in providing software solutions for autonomous vehicle operations, primarily targeting the logistics and transportation sectors. The company's competitive edge lies in its proprietary technology that enhances fleet management and operational efficiency, particularly in urban environments.
Cyngn generates revenue primarily through software licensing agreements with logistics companies, enabling them to optimize fleet operations. The company leverages its unique algorithms and data analytics capabilities, providing a competitive advantage in improving operational efficiencies and reducing costs for clients.
